Leaving No-One Behind (2018)

The 2018 Irish Aid Annual Professor Michael Kelly Lecture on HIV/AIDS will take place in Smock Alley Theatre on December 11 at 5:00 pm.

This year’s lecture will include a video address from Father Michael Kelly in Zambia, and will be moderated by broadcaster and entertainer, Dil Wickramesinghe. The lecture will feature opening and closing addresses by Nicola Brennan, Policy Unit Director at Irish Aid and Minister of State for the Diaspora and International Development, Ciaran Cannon T.D.

The 2018 special invited speakers are Dr Oanh Khuat, Executive Director of SCDI Vietnam, Rory O’Neill/Panti Bliss, HIV activist and entertainer, and Robbie Lawlor, HIV activist with Youth Stop AIDS and ACT UP Dublin.
